How much did federal committees report paying Outfront Media?

$189,708.32 across current organization-payment rows in the 2026 FEC operating-expenditures file.

This is an aggregate by normalized filing name. It is not revenue, profit, a verified contract total, or proof that similarly named legal entities are the same organization.

Source: Federal Election Commission Schedule B operating expenditures.

Method boundary

Payee names are evidence, not conclusions.

Organizations only

Individual payees are excluded from this published store.

Amendment-normalized

5,103 superseded transaction versions were removed using committee, report, and transaction identifiers.

Memo rows excluded

343,673 memo-code X rows are excluded from totals because the FEC says they are not included in the itemization total.

Conservative matching

Punctuation and a small set of corporate suffixes are normalized. Election.org does not perform unverified corporate-family resolution.
